VPN vs Proxy Traffic

In the realm of online privacy and data transmission, two main technologies often compared are VPNs and proxy servers. Even though both serve as middlemen for your internet traffic, they function in essentially different ways, influencing your security, privacy, and overall online experience. This article explores the contrasts between VPN traffic and proxy traffic.

At its core, both a VPN and a proxy are designed to mask your real IP address by directing your connection through a remote server. This process makes your online activity appear as if it is originating from the server's location, thereby offering a layer of anonymity. However, the resemblance often ends there.

**Deciphering Proxy Traffic**

A proxy server acts as a gateway between you and the internet. When you utilize a proxy, your internet traffic is sent through this intermediary before reaching its target website. The key trait of standard proxy traffic—especially with HTTP and SOCKS proxies—is that it usually does **not** include encryption. Think of it as sending a letter through a secretary; the recipient only sees the proxy's return address, but the text of the postcard remains in plain sight to anyone who handles it.

Proxy traffic is often limited to one app. You usually configure a proxy for a single task, such as your web browser. This means other apps on your device, like email clients or games, will still go around the proxy and expose your real IP address. Consequently, proxies are best suited for focused tasks like accessing geo-blocked content on a website, web scraping, or managing multiple social media accounts. The advantage is that, without the overhead of encryption, proxy traffic can be quicker. The risk, however, is a complete lack of data security.

**Deciphering VPN Traffic**

A Virtual Private Network (VPN) creates a protected connection, often described as a "tunnel," between your device and a VPN server. The defining difference is that **all** data passing through this tunnel is secured. This encryption acts like a tamper-proof envelope around your data, rendering it gibberish to anyone who might intercept it—including your Internet Service Provider (ISP), hackers on public Wi-Fi, or even the VPN server itself.

VPN traffic is encompassing. Once the VPN is activated at the operating system level, it secures all internet traffic from your device. Whether you are browsing the web, using a messaging app, or checking email, all data is routed through this encrypted tunnel. This turns VPNs the preferred choice for overall privacy, securing sensitive data (like banking details), and maintaining anonymity from ISPs and other monitoring eyes. Although the encryption process can slightly impact connection speeds, modern VPN protocols and well-developed infrastructures often make this slowdown very minor.

**Main Contrasts at a Glance**

To summarize the comparison between proxy and VPN traffic, consider the following:

· **Encryption:** This is the core difference. VPN traffic is fully encrypted, safeguarding your data from interception. Proxy traffic is typically not encrypted, leaving your data unprotected.

· **Scope of Protection:** A VPN covers all internet traffic from your device, providing a consistent layer of security. A proxy only covers traffic from the particular application or browser tab it is set up for.

· **Use Case:** Proxies are best for basic tasks like unblocking region-locked content or performing isolated testing. VPNs are ideal for full-scale online privacy, security on public Wi-Fi, and protecting all your online communications.

· **Speed:** Proxies can be quicker due to the absence of encryption, but they are often unreliable and slow, especially free ones. VPNs may have a slight speed penalty due to encryption, but premium services read more offer fast connections.

**Making the Choice**

The choice between using a proxy or a VPN hinges upon your individual needs. For quick IP masking where security is not a concern, a proxy may be adequate. However, for any activity involving personal data, for ensuring privacy from your ISP, or for securing all the devices in your home, a VPN is the clear choice. A VPN does not just hide your IP address; it creates a secure tunnel for your data to travel through, offering a level of protection a proxy simply cannot match.
